About Carly ED0134
Meet Carly!
This gorgeous girl hasn’t had the best start in life, so she is now looking for a special someone to give her a much needed happy ending.
Carly was abandoned at the scene of a car rollover and rescued by the local police. No one came forward to claim her, so she came into the care of SAFE Esperance.
Carly is a very loving, friendly girl who is confident with people and other dogs. She has been around cats but would need a confident cat who won’t run from her, as Carly would probably try to play and chase. A gentle introduction would be needed.
She loves to play with her foster brother and can be a little ‘full on’ with her play, so we would recommend a home with a male dog of similar size or bigger to keep her in line.
Carly loves to run on the beach and would need a walk at least once a day to keep her happy and healthy. She knows some basic commands and would benefit greatly from ongoing training and socialisation.
Her ideal home will have a large secure yard, and she would suit a family with slightly older children who will include her in their daily life and outings. She will need to be able to sleep inside the house at night.
